On Jan 4, 2008, at 6:20 AM, Hendrik Holtmann wrote:

Hi everyone,

I got another question regarding the new setView method in Leopard.
Let's assume I set the view for an NSMenuItem to myView. myView contains an NSTextField. Now when I open the NSMenu I want to set the focus on this textfield, so the user can directly enter some text without having to click on the control first (like it works in the spotlight menu). How can I achieve that? I know how to call keyOrderAndFront and setFirstRespinder for NSWindows but how can I do this with an NSMenu. Setting the firstresponder for myView to the NSTextField does not help unfortunately.

Probably the easiest approach would be to override viewDidMoveToWindow on the view that will be in the menu, and from within it call [[self window] makeFirstResponder:self];. makeFirstResponder is one of a very few methods that is safe to call on the menu window.
